CIDE DICTIONARY

psychophysicsn. [Psycho- + physics.].
     The science of the connection between nerve action and consciousness; the science which treats of the relations of the psychical and physical in their conjoint operation in man; the doctrine of the relation of function or dependence between body and soul.  [1913 Webster]

OXFORD DICTIONARY

psychophysics, n. the science of the relation between the mind and the body.
